Analysis# Belgium Fertility Rate
Belgium's fertility rate stands at 1.44 births per woman in 2024, marking both a historic low and the culmination of a 64-year decline. Since 1960, the rate has dropped 43.3% from higher baseline levels, falling far short of the 1964 peak of 2.71 births per woman. The country now sits well below the 2.1 replacement level needed to maintain population without immigration.
The steepest declines occurred between 1960 and the mid-1980s, with fertility stabilizing around 1.6–1.7 births per woman through the 2010s. Recent years show continued compression, particularly from 2019 onward, when the rate dipped below 1.6 and has remained in downward motion. Belgium's trajectory reflects broader Western European patterns, driven by delayed childbearing, increased female workforce participation, and lower desired family sizes. Without significant fertility reversals or compensatory migration, these figures suggest continued demographic pressure ahead.
Historical Data
65 Rows| Year | Value | Change % |
|---|---|---|
| 2024 | 1.44 births per woman | -2.04% |
| 2023 | 1.47 births per woman | -3.92% |
| 2022 | 1.53 births per woman | -4.38% |
| 2021 | 1.6 births per woman | +3.23% |
| 2020 | 1.55 births per woman | -3.13% |
| 2019 | 1.6 births per woman | -1.23% |
| 2018 | 1.62 births per woman | -1.82% |
| 2017 | 1.65 births per woman | -1.79% |
| 2016 | 1.68 births per woman | -1.18% |
| 2015 | 1.7 births per woman | -2.30% |
| 2014 | 1.74 births per woman | -1.14% |
| 2013 | 1.76 births per woman | -2.22% |
| 2012 | 1.8 births per woman | -0.55% |
| 2011 | 1.81 births per woman | -2.69% |
| 2010 | 1.86 births per woman | +1.09% |
| 2009 | 1.84 births per woman | -0.54% |
| 2008 | 1.85 births per woman | +1.65% |
| 2007 | 1.82 births per woman | +1.11% |
| 2006 | 1.8 births per woman | +2.27% |
| 2005 | 1.76 births per woman | +2.33% |
